Five countries officially secured their 2026 FIFA World Cup tickets through playoff routes on Tuesday, with DR Congo making history. The African nation beat Jamaica 1-0 thanks to Axel Tuanzebe's dramatic extra-time winner. In major upsets, Bosnia and Herzegovina eliminated Italy on penalties after a 1-1 draw, while Sweden defeated Poland 3-2. Turkey ended a 24-year wait by beating Kosovo 1-0, and Czechia overcame Denmark on penalties after a 2-2 draw. The final remaining spot will be decided when Iraq faces Bolivia on Wednesday. DR Congo's qualification means another African team joins the tournament, while Italy's absence represents one of the biggest shocks in recent World Cup qualification history.
